What is a Living Room Side Table?

A living room side table, often referred to as an accent table or end table, is a small table that typically sits beside a sofa or chair. It serves multiple purposes, such as holding beverages, books, lamps, or decorative items. The right side table can enhance the overall aesthetic of your living room while offering practical utility.

Types of Living Room Side Tables

  • Traditional Side Tables: These are classic designs that often feature intricate details and ornate carvings, suitable for traditional or vintage-styled living rooms.
  • Modern Side Tables: Sleek lines and minimalistic designs characterize these tables, making them perfect for contemporary spaces.
  • Glass Side Tables: Offering a chic look, glass side tables create an illusion of space and can easily blend in with any decor.
  • Wood Side Tables: Durable and sturdy, wooden side tables provide warmth and texture—perfect for rustic or farmhouse-inspired interiors.
  • Multi-functional Side Tables: These tables often come with additional storage options, such as drawers or shelves, allowing for versatile use.

Choosing the Right Living Room Side Table

When selecting the ideal side table for your living room, consider the following factors:

  • Size: Ensure the table is proportionate to your seating area. A good rule of thumb is to have the table’s height align with the armrest of your sofa for easy access.
  • Style: Choose a design that complements your existing furniture. Whether you prefer rustic, contemporary, or eclectic styles, the right table can tie your room together.
  • Material: Consider the durability and care of the material. For high-traffic areas, opt for sturdy options like wood or metal.
  • Functionality: Think about how you’ll use the table. If you frequently entertain guests, a larger table with more surface area might be ideal. For a cozy reading nook, pick a smaller, simple design.

Accessorizing Your Side Table

Once you have selected your living room side table, accessorizing it will enhance its functionality and aesthetics. Here are a few tips:

  • Add a Lamp: A stylish lamp can provide light and create an inviting atmosphere.
  • Incorporate Decorative Items: Use books, vases, or artwork to express your personal style.
  • Keep It Functional: Use coasters, trays, or bowls to keep your side table tidy and organized.
